Terminalling and transportation company TransMontaigne Partners LP has enjoyed a prosperous 2016 as it benefited from the re-contracting of storage capacity and stronger revenues from its facilities along the US Gulf Coast.
The company expects to benefit from the expansion of a major terminal in Mississippi that is in its final phase. Industrial Info is tracking US$423 million in active projects involving TransMontaigne.
